Skip to content

Commit

Permalink
fix: linting
Browse files Browse the repository at this point in the history
  • Loading branch information
MarkProminic authored Aug 17, 2024
1 parent d62952d commit e908e4d
Showing 1 changed file with 5 additions and 7 deletions.
12 changes: 5 additions & 7 deletions lib/vagrant-zones/driver.rb
Original file line number Diff line number Diff line change
Expand Up @@ -1045,25 +1045,23 @@ def zonecfgnicconfig(uii, opts)
defrouter = opts[:gateway].to_s
vnic_name = vname(uii, opts)
config = @machine.provider_config

uii.info(I18n.t('vagrant_zones.vnic_setup'))
uii.info(" #{vnic_name}")

strt = "#{@pfexec} zonecfg -z #{@machine.name} "
cie = config.cloud_init_enabled
aa = config.allowed_address

case config.brand
when 'lx'
shrtstr1 = %(set allowed-address=#{allowed_address}; add property (name=gateway,value="#{defrouter}"); )
shrtstr2 = %(add property (name=ips,value="#{allowed_address}"); add property (name=primary,value="true"); end;)
execute(false, %(#{strt}set global-nic=auto; #{shrtstr1} #{shrtstr2}"))
when 'bhyve'
vlan_option = opts[:vlan].nil? || opts[:vlan].zero? ? '' : "set vlan-id=#{opts[:vlan]}; "
base_cmd = config.on_demand_vnics ? \
%(#{strt}"add net; set physical=#{vnic_name}; #{vlan_option}set global-nic=#{opts[:bridge]}; ) : \
%(#{strt}"add net; set physical=#{vnic_name}; )

if config.on_demand_vnics
base_cmd = %(#{strt}"add net; set physical=#{vnic_name}; #{vlan_option}set global-nic=#{opts[:bridge]}; )
else
base_cmd = %(#{strt}"add net; set physical=#{vnic_name}; )
end
execute(false, %(#{base_cmd}end;)) unless cie
execute(false, %(#{base_cmd}set allowed-address=#{allowed_address}; end;)) if cie && aa
execute(false, %(#{base_cmd}end;)) if cie && !aa
Expand Down

0 comments on commit e908e4d

Please sign in to comment.